Meth Detox in Southwood Acres, Connecticut

It is extremely essential for anyone in Southwood Acres who wants to really conquer meth addiction to undergo meth detox within a drug and alcohol treatment facility or alcohol and drug detoxification facility. The reason being is individuals who are addicted to meth in Southwood Acres, Connecticut and begin to detox are begin experiencing withdrawal symptoms and cravings which bring about relapse in virtually all cases if no inside a drug and alcohol rehab facility or drug detox environment. Meth withdrawal symptoms can be very extreme both physically and mentally, and these symptoms can persist at varying levels for weeks and even months in some cases. Folks who don't have the most beneficial care through meth detox really don't have a real chance at remaining clean. So if someone does want to make an honest effort, it's best to achieve this with professional help in the Southwood Acres, CT. area.

Meth detox is known as one of the most challenging, so detoxification professionals at programs that assist individuals through meth detox in Southwood Acres are ready t help even the worst scenarios. Irritability, depression and changes in moods are typical if somebody is going through meth detox in Southwood Acres, Connecticut, so it is very important to provide a safe and non-restimulative environment and remove the person from any sort of environment that could result in relapse and disappointments. Detoxification professionals in a alcohol and drug rehabilitation program or alcohol and drug detox facility in Southwood Acres, CT. will also encourage and even insist that individuals follow-up meth detox with actual rehabilitation, otherwise there is absolutely no real hope for people to stay clean without having done so.
